  1. Leslie Harburd Southwick (born February 10, 1950) is a United States circuit judge of the United States Court of Appeals for the Fifth Circuit and a former judge of the Mississippi Court of Appeals .

  5. Judge Leslie H. Southwick was confirmed on October 24, 2007, to the U.S. Court of Appeals for the Fifth Circuit, which hears appeals from the federal district courts of Louisiana, Mississippi, and Texas. Judge Leslie H. Southwick is a highly respected attorney with an extensive record of public service as a judge and military officer.
